I was wondering if there was an option to get sharper (ie faster) steering on my MY98 Turbo.
In my (humble) opinion the steering is too damn slow.

Any insights ? Pricing and availability are nice ;-)

Subaru do a quick steering rack as fitted to the 22b and some Type RA's. Better be sitting down though cos they cost about £1400 I believe.

STI 13:1 Quick ratio steering rack...have one on mine. Possibly one of the best mods I've done to it. £1500 fitted.

How about an uprated rear anti roll bar ? It reduces understeer by making the rear end do more work. Requires less steering input for same turn-in and a better balanced car overall.
Anti lift and bump steer mod can also help.
